Bio
2021 (Senior): Played in all 11 games, making five starts at cornerback ... served as game captain at then No. 11/12 Villanova ... made 16 tackles (10 solo) ... posted a tackle for a loss against Penn and Lehigh ... intercepted a pass against Lehigh ... broke up a pass against Holy Cross ... made a season-high five tackles at Army West Point ... returned three kickoffs for 53 yards, all coming against Penn ... earned Bucknell's Tom Gadd Coaches' Award ... member of Patriot League Academic Honor Roll.
2021 Spring (Junior): Started all four games at cornerback ... made eight tackles (four solo) ... posted a season-high three tackles against Lafayette and Lehigh ... returned three kickoffs for 53 yards, with 34 yards coming on two returns against Fordham.
2019 (Sophomore): Played in all 11 games, starting final 10 at cornerback ... posted 35 tackles (26 solo) and four pass breakups ... made at least five tackles three times, topping out at six in the finale at Fordham ... against the Rams, also returned first career interception 39 yards for a touchdown ... led the Bison with 165 yards on 10 kickoff returns ... registered a season-best 35 yards on two returns against Holy Cross.
2018 (Freshman): Saw action on special teams in eight games ... reserve cornerback ... made four tackles, two of which came at Holy Cross on Sept. 29.
Independence High School: Three-year letterwinner in football and four-year letterwinner in track & field … two-time all-district selection in football … member of team’s defensive leadership council … finished high-school career with 24 total touchdowns, five kick return touchdowns, eight interceptions, 64 pass breakups and 48 tackles … caught first ever interception at the Dallas Cowboys’ practice facility, The Star in Frisco, during Independence’s game against Reedy in 2016.
Personal: Micah Dennis … born December 9, 1999 in Dallas, Texas … son of Christopher Dennis and Sabrina and André Bryant … has two sisters: Marianna Dennis and Zoe Bryant … uncle Patrick Dennis played collegiate football for Louisiana Monroe and went on to play in the NFL for the Washington Redskins, Dallas Cowboys and Houston Texans … father Christopher played football at Grambling University … stepfather André was a member of the football and track & field teams at Sterling College … major was biology.
